一般描述
4-硝基苯基-N-乙酰基-β-D-半乳糖胺是N-乙酰基-β-D-半乳糖苷酶和d N-乙酰基-β-D-己糖胺酶的发色底物。它具有膜透过性性,可作为高尔基囊泡中6-磺基转移酶的底物。
应用
4-硝基苯基-N-乙酰基-β-D-半乳糖胺已被:
- 用作假结核耶尔森氏菌蛋白的糖基水解酶测定中的合成底物
- 用作人类肺腺癌基底上皮细胞A549中-β-己糖胺酶测定的底物
- 用作大鼠肾脏组织提取物中N-乙酰-β-D-半乳糖苷酶测定的底物
